Развертывание Angular 2 (приложение быстрого запуска) на платформе Google Cloud

Я пытался развернуть самый простой проект на платформе Google Cloud. Быстрый старт проекта можно найтиВот, Локально это работает без проблем.

Однако все сложнее заставить его работать в Google Cloud. Я знаю, что есть много других провайдеров, таких как Heroku, с развертыванием в один клик, но я нахожу странным, что это не так легко сделать с помощью службы Google.

app.yaml

runtime: nodejs
env: flex

Package.json - как предусмотрено в проекте быстрого стартаВот

Первая ошибка, которую я получаю при развертывании (gclould app deploy):

[email protected] start /app
tsc && concurrently "tsc -w" "lite-server"
sh: 1: tsc: not found

Затем я добавляю в package.json:

"preinstall": "npm install tsc",

Вторая ошибка:

tsc && concurrently "tsc -w" "lite-server"
error TS5023: Unknown compiler option 'moduleResolution'.
error TS5023: Unknown compiler option 'lib'.

Здесь я потерялся.

Конечно, я использую местоположение, которое поддерживает flex.

Любые идеи, если я копаю проблему в правильном пути или я должен просто воссоздать свой проект, используя простое руководство, которое можно найти по адресу codelabs.developers.google.com/codelabs/cloud-cardboard-viewer/

Ответы на вопрос(1)

Ваш ответ на вопрос